The Deer's Daring Escape: A Race Against Shadows

In the heart of the ancient forest, where the trees whispered secrets of old and the shadows danced with the moonlight, there lived a young deer named Liora. Her coat was a tapestry of autumn leaves, blending seamlessly with the forest floor. Liora was no ordinary deer; she was born with a gift—a keen sense of danger that had saved her life more than once.

One crisp autumn morning, as the sun cast a golden glow over the forest, Liora's tranquil existence was shattered by the sound of footsteps. She looked up to see a hunter, a man with a cruel smile and a gleaming knife, stepping into her world. The hunter had tracked her for days, driven by a thirst for the thrill of the hunt and the taste of venison.

Liora's heart raced as she darted into the underbrush, her hooves kicking up leaves in a blur. The hunter followed, his eyes narrowing with determination. She could hear his breath, a harsh panting that echoed through the forest. The chase was on, and Liora knew she had to outsmart him.

She leaped over fallen logs, her legs moving with the grace of a fawn, but the hunter was relentless. The forest seemed to close in around her, the shadows whispering warnings of her impending doom. She could feel the hunter's presence closing in, the sound of his footsteps growing louder.

As the sun began to dip below the horizon, the forest transformed into a place of fear and danger. The shadows grew longer, darker, and more menacing. Liora's senses were heightened, and she knew she had to find a place to hide. She sprinted deeper into the forest, her breath coming in ragged gasps.

The hunter's voice echoed behind her, a relentless commando on the hunt. "You can't hide forever, little deer!"

Liora's eyes darted from side to side, searching for a place to escape. She stumbled upon a narrow cave, its entrance hidden by thick vines and foliage. With a burst of speed, she darted inside, the hunter hot on her heels.

The cave was dark and damp, the air thick with moisture. Liora's heart pounded in her chest as she scurried deeper into the darkness. She could hear the hunter's footsteps stop at the entrance, then the sound of him searching for her.

The cave twisted and turned, its walls close enough to touch. Liora's eyes adjusted to the darkness, and she saw a narrow passage leading deeper into the cave. She knew she had to keep moving, or she would be caught.

The hunter's voice echoed through the cave, "You're not getting away this time!"

Liora's legs pumped, and she pressed on, her heart a drumbeat in her chest. She came upon a dead-end, but a faint glimmer of light caught her eye. She followed the light, her fingers brushing against the cool stone as she moved forward.

The light grew brighter, and Liora's eyes widened in relief as she saw the cave opening up to a hidden chamber. The hunter's voice grew distant, and she knew she had found her escape. She burst out of the cave, the forest once again her sanctuary.

The hunter's footsteps echoed behind her, but Liora had gained the upper hand. She ran as fast as she could, her heart pounding with the thrill of survival. She could hear the hunter's voice fading, and she knew she had won this round.

But Liora knew that the hunter would not give up so easily. She had to stay one step ahead, to outsmart him at every turn. The forest was her home, and she would do whatever it took to protect it.

As the sun began to rise, Liora took a moment to rest, her breath coming in ragged gasps. She looked around, her eyes scanning the forest for any sign of the hunter. But there was nothing, just the tranquil sounds of the forest waking up to a new day.

Liora knew that her journey was far from over. The hunter would come again, and she would have to be ready. But for now, she had won her freedom, and she would use it to protect her home and her family.

The forest was alive with the sounds of life, the rustling of leaves, the chirping of birds. Liora felt a sense of peace wash over her, a reminder that she was not alone in this world. She had friends, other animals who would help her when the time came.

As she continued her journey, Liora knew that the forest was a place of both beauty and danger. But she also knew that she had a gift, a gift that would help her survive. And as long as she had that gift, she would never be truly alone.

The Deer's Daring Escape: A Race Against Shadows was a story of survival, of a young deer's courage in the face of danger, and of the unbreakable bond between a creature and its home.
